JUST IN: BBNaija’s Laycon Launches New Reality TV Series (Video)

Big Brother Naija, season 5 winner, Olamilekan Agbeleshe popularly known as “Laycon“ is in to excite his fans as he set to launch a new reality TV show.
The show powered by Showmax is titled, “I am Laycon,” it would premier in February 2021 and would show Laycon’s life after emerging winner of the BBnaija show.
ShowMax is an online video streaming service just like Netflix, it is offered across Africa by the owners of DSTV and GoTV, Multichoice.
According to reports, ‘’I am Laycon’’ shot in Nigeria, will be Showmax’s first-ever Nigerian original series.
The organisers said the reality show would also give an exclusive insight into the artist’s personal relationships and growing music career.

Laycon in his reaction on his social media platforms, Instagram where he has over 2 million followers and Twitter on Tuesday shared: “I am excited to continue my new life journey and embrace the new responsibilities and evolving not just myself but everyone around me.
‘’I want you to come along for the ride as you get to see the growth that you have supported and love.’’
Laycon is presently working on his album.
“Expect more from Laycon.”
